The Prestige World Tour was the sixth headlining concert tour by the Puero Rican artist Daddy Yankee, launched in support of his seventh studio album Prestige (2012). The majority of the venues in United States (unlike the previous tour) were nightclubs because it was easier for him to promote his liquor "Cartel Tequila". However, in Europe he performed at bigger venues and arenas. The tour marked his third consecutive visit to Europe as a headliner.
The show at Movistar Arena in Chile had attendance of 12,000 fans according to local media. The concert at the Festival Viva Ventanilla reported an attendance of more than 20,000. Also, his presentation in Conquimbo, Chile at the Pampilla de Coquimbo Music Festival had a total attendance of 150,000 according to local media. While in Spain, the concert co-headlined by Prince Royce was reported sold out. In the same way, the concert in Quito, Ecuador had more than 28,000 tickets sold. The European leg had a total attendance of over 100,000 fans.
